Palmyra Films
Queen of the Desert
2015
Movie
Smooth Talk
1985
Movie
Screen Generation: Sick Generation?
2020
Movie
Nausicaa: The Largest Aquarium in Europe
2019
Movie
Giono, une âme forte
2020
Movie
Auschwitz: The Inside Man
2022
Movie
Infiltré à Auschwitz
2021
Movie
Dollar or Egyptian Pound?
2024
Movie